Hi folks, this is my first post so I hope I am in the correct section!
I drive a Dobolo which I have had for about 6 years and I love it. My wife drives a new Panda which she loves too. However I have problem as when I drive her car the head rest is very very uncomfortable. Even when it is raised to its top position the top only reaches to the back of my head not only forcing it forward but I am sure that a rear shunt would cause my head some damage. I have tried lifting it above the upper setting and can rest my head as it should be but as soon as I move the headrest drops back down again as there is no fitting at this height.
I have tried using the central rear seat headrest from my Dobolo and this proves to be comfortable just slid into to seat holes but the rods are much thinner on the Dobolo rest so I am not sure of the safety it supplies,
I wish I wasn't so tall!
Any suggestions please?
 
It is not a head rest, it is a head restraint.
It is not for leaning your head against while driving. It is only to prevent your head bending over the back of the seat in a rear shunt.
Ideally top of restraint should be adjusted to just below top of your head, or at its top setting if that is the closest you can get. Above the top setting is likely to come adrift in a shunt, so not saving you.
